1
ответ

использование приветствия в качестве основы для блокировки приложения

Я любитель (, а не ИТ-специалист ), и у меня просто возникла идея написать приложение/скрипт для блокировки экрана, чтобы изучать и повторять регулярное выражение. Я мог бы использовать bash или Python, но не знаю, с чего начать. Не могли бы вы указать мн
17.02.2021
1
ответ

Запускать скрипт Python при запуске

У меня есть сценарий, с которым я запускаю python3 /path/script.py Я не могу понять, как заставить скрипт запускаться при запуске. Любые указатели были бы замечательными!
14.02.2021
1
ответ

Заставить программу Linux работать следующие 50 лет?

У меня есть программа, работающая на Ubuntu 16.04 LTS, которая завершается через 2 месяца. Программа представляет собой приложение Python 2, использующее QT4. Он отлично работает, и я хочу перенести его на Ubuntu 20. Не так быстро, как Python2, так и...
07.02.2021
1
ответ

Сделать файлы доступными для чтения -только -кроме программы, которая их создает

Итак, у меня возникла ситуация, когда программа X.py создает такие файлы, как file1.txt. Как можно сделать так, чтобы только programX.py имел права редактировать (писать в )file1.txt? Итак, что-нибудь еще (, например, пользователь )...
04.02.2021
1
ответ

Как запустить непрерывную службу Python в Linux?

Недавно я создал сервис с помощью Python. Он содержит while True :, который оказывает услугу. Учитывая, что я впервые предлагаю что-то вроде услуги и беру с клиента деньги, у меня есть некоторые...
03.02.2021
1
ответ

Как установить pip без root-доступа в Ubuntu > 18.04 без установленного пакета distutils

Я хотел бы установить pip в любой из моих виртуальных сред, созданных с помощью venv, но для сценария get -pip.py требуется пакет distutils, который не установлен на сервере, который я использую, и я...
31.01.2021
1
ответ

Не удается установить libQtGui.so.4 на Centos 8

Для проверки компьютерного зрения (Машинное обучение )Мне нужно установить OIDv4 _ToolKit Я следую инструкциям в ссылке. На Centos 8 я использовал :установка conda --требования к файлу.txt но потом, когда...
30.01.2021
1
ответ

Когда я пытаюсь запустить gnome -tweaks, он возвращает мне ошибки приложения, которые я не могу понять, и оболочка остается зависшей

Я использую Arch Linux с Linux 5.10.11 с GNOME 3.38.3, и когда я пытаюсь запустить Tweaks из меню, ничего не происходит. Итак, когда я пытаюсь запустить настройки gnome -из bash, он возвращает мне эту ошибку, оставшуюся...
29.01.2021
1
ответ

Почему «get -pip.py» жалуется на неверный синтаксис?

Я пытаюсь установить pip3 без прав sudo, следуя приведенному здесь ответу. Первым шагом является выполнение следующего :wget https://bootstrap.pypa.io/get-pip.pyВроде работает...
27.01.2021
1
ответ

Почему я получаю сообщение об ошибке Unicode при передаче вывода, содержащего Unicode, из Python 2 в grep?

У меня есть скрипт Python для вывода кодовых точек Unicode и имен символов для набора полезных символов на терминал (xfce4 -терминал ). Он становится немного большим, поэтому я попытался передать вывод...
26.01.2021
1
ответ

xhost :не удалось открыть дисплей «рабочий стол :0»

ОБНОВЛЕНИЕ 1 :Я не использую SSH. Я использую локальную машину. ОБНОВЛЕНИЕ 2 :Я перезапустил X и заметил, что файл Xauthority, в который я экспортирую, действительно обновляется :$ sudo systemctl перезапустить...
26.01.2021
1
ответ

Почему мой процесс Python не может получить доступ ко всей памяти?

У меня 62 ГБ ОЗУ на сервере Linux, и мой код Python пытается загрузить в память файл размером 20 ГБ. Однако он падает и выдает MemoryError. Я не уверен, почему это так? Я знаю, я...
22.01.2021
1
ответ

Вызов подпроцесса Python для insmod приводит к ошибке неопределенного символа, он работает из стандартной оболочки

Мне нужно зарегистрировать определенный модуль ядра(https://github.com/504ensicsLabs/LiME)в Ubuntu 18.04. sudo insmod /path/to/lime.ko path= ~/dump.raw format=raw из скрипта Python. я пытался использовать ос....
22.01.2021
1
ответ

Сценарий Python не имеет стандартного вывода при запуске через i3blocks

В i3blocks,Я определил такой блок :~/.config/i3blocks/config :[тестовое задание] интервал = сохранить format=json Соответствующий исполняемый скрипт :~/.config/i3blocks/config.scripts/тест :#!/usr/bin/...
20.01.2021
1
ответ

Почему на моей Ubuntu по умолчанию установлено четыре разные версии Python?

Я новичок в linux и мучаюсь с альтернативным управлением установкой для python. Мне удалось изменить версии Python по умолчанию для sudo и root (, если я правильно понимаю ). Однако я бы...
20.01.2021
1
ответ

/usr/bin/python :плохой интерпретатор :Нет такого файла или каталога (Удалены пакеты python, теперь python не работает и yum не работает)

Я удалял OpenSSH с помощью следующей команды :for i in $ (об/мин -qa | grep openssh );do sudo rpm -e $i --nodeps;done Затем по какой-то причине, я не знаю, почему я подумал, что это хорошая идея, я побежал...
20.01.2021
1
ответ

Попытка запустить два скрипта Python с помощью Cron при запуске

Я поместил следующие команды в файл crontab :@reboot python3 /home/pi/rpi _камера _наблюдение _system.py & @reboot python3 /home/pi/KestrelPi/PIRkestrellogger.py & Первый скрипт...
10.01.2021
1
ответ

Список только указателей с xinput

Я пытаюсь написать инструмент с графическим интерфейсом, чтобы ограничить указатель определенным монитором (, например. указатель сенсорного экрана должен отображаться на своем собственном экране, а не на объединении всех мониторов ). Инструмент находится
06.01.2021
1
ответ

Как проверить и перечислить, какие расширения сценариев bash или python, используемые «расширениями», уже установлены или их еще нужно установить?

Некоторые скрипты используют некоторые дополнительные компоненты, такие как xdotool и другие дополнительные компоненты, которые необходимо установить на машину, на которой запущен скрипт bash или python. Есть ли хоть один скрипт или вроде этого, который..
03.01.2021
1
ответ

Добавлять две строки, содержащие комментарии и URL-адреса, перед определенной строкой в ​​сценариях Python -с использованием sed

В некоторых из моих сценариев Python -я поместил строку if __name __== '__main __', чтобы содержимое выполнялось только тогда, когда скрипт запускается как основной -скрипт (, а не импортируется, см....
22.12.2020
1
ответ

Команда для получения текущих установленных версий тех, которые перечислены с помощью «>=» в файле требований (PIP )с помощью grep/xargs

У меня есть файл requirements.txt с перечисленными версиями, например. #требования.txt каналы==2.4.0 цветорама>=0,2,3 дафна==2.5.0 django -q>=1.1.4 Для версий с == PIP устанавливает именно эту версию...
21.12.2020
1
ответ

Как установить recoll-зависимости "djvutxt" и "python3 :pylzma"?

Я установил recoll на свой Kubuntu 20.04. Теперь пишет, что отсутствуют внешние приложения и команды, необходимые для индексации, в частности :djvutxt (изображение/vnd.djvu )python3 :пыльцма (...
16.12.2020
1
ответ

Как запустить ffmpeg, чтобы сделать x скриншотов?

Я использую ffmpeg для создания скриншотов twitch-стримеров, используя этот код :counter = 0, в то время как counter <= 5 :os.system ('ffmpeg -i '+ stream + f' -r 0,5 -f image2 {dir _path}/output _%09d.jpg' )...
10.12.2020
1
ответ

Использует ли мой сервер шифрование SSL для доставки электронной -почты?

Я развернул небольшой почтовый сервер с помощью sendmail. Я думаю, что агент правильно настроен для приема запросов на доставку как с шифрованием, так и без него. Это потому, что со следующим телнетом...
10.12.2020
1
ответ

Linux-команда генерации хеша MD6 для 128 -бит, 256 -бит, 512 -бит хэшей MD6

в основных утилитах GNU в большинстве дистрибутивов Linux есть несколько команд контрольной суммы для известных алгоритмов хеширования, таких как SHA2 или MD5, но мне нужна команда для MD6 (дайджест сообщения 6 )контрольная сумма, которая может...
06.12.2020
1
ответ

python :мульти -файл данных столбца pandas

Я работаю над скриптом Python, который перебирает N файлов.SDF, создает их список с помощью glob, выполняет некоторые вычисления для каждого файла, а затем сохраняет эту информацию в файле данных pandas...
01.12.2020
1
ответ

Как установить конкретную версию Python?

Я пытаюсь установить Python 3.7.0 на WSL (Ubuntu 20.04 ). Пробовал :sudo apt install python3.7.0 Но пишет, что такого пакета нет. Использование :sudo apt install python3.7 устанавливает python 3.7.9 и...
30.11.2020
1
ответ

Проблема при попытке открыть приложение Legion

судо легион Traceback (последний звонок последний ):Файл "/usr/share/legion/legion.py", строка 19, из app.ProjectManager import ProjectManager Файл "/usr/share/legion/app/ProjectManager....
29.11.2020
1
ответ

Fish :Файл не может быть выполнен этим пользователем

Я создал функцию fish в ~/.config/fish/functions/confgit.fish :функция confgit /home/john/Projects/confgit $argv конец Но когда я запускаю эту функцию, она просто говорит :рыба :Файл «/home/john/...
29.11.2020
1
ответ

Как получить данные из проигрывателя VLC

Мне нужна команда или код Python, чтобы получить все данные, такие как имя файла, который воспроизводится в VLC, и часы :минуты :секунды видео. Пример вывода :pc@system :$ Файл командной строки :/home/rev/...
29.11.2020